/**
* The purpose of this tool is to transform a single javaxmi package, to bunch
* of package chunks, accordingly to the initial package name.
*
* @author Maxence Vanbésien (mvaawl@gmail.com)
* @since 1.0
*
*/
public class PackageChunker {
/**
* Update the packages of the provided model
*
* @param model
*/
public static void chunkPackages(final Model model) {
for (final Package pack : model.getOwnedElements()) {
PackageChunker.chunkPackage(pack);
for (final Package subPack : pack.getOwnedPackages())
PackageChunker.chunkPackage(subPack);
}
}
/**
* Update the processed package
*/
@SuppressWarnings({ "rawtypes", "unchecked" })
private static void chunkPackage(final Package pack) {
final String name = pack.getName();
final String[] nameChunks = name.split("\\.");
if (nameChunks.length > 1) {
final Package[] packages = new Package[nameChunks.length];
packages[0] = pack;
pack.setName(nameChunks[0]);
for (int i = 1; i < nameChunks.length; i++) {
final Package packageChunk = JavaFactory.eINSTANCE.createPackage();
packageChunk.setName(nameChunks[i]);
packages[i] = packageChunk;
packageChunk.setPackage(packages[i - 1]);
}
final Package lastPackage = packages[nameChunks.length - 1];
final Collection<EObject> contentsToProcess = new ArrayList<EObject>();
contentsToProcess.addAll(pack.eContents());
for (final EObject eObject : contentsToProcess)
if (!(eObject instanceof Package)) {
final EReference eReference = eObject.eContainmentFeature();
if (eReference.isMany())
((EList) lastPackage.eGet(eReference)).add(eObject);
else
lastPackage.eSet(eReference, eObject);
}
for (final CompilationUnit compilationUnit : pack.getModel().getCompilationUnits())
if (compilationUnit.getPackage() == pack)
compilationUnit.setPackage(lastPackage);
}
}
}
